Material profile
PETG-CF
Use it for: structural brackets, RC and drone parts, heat-adjacent functional prints.
PETG-CF · slicer settings
| Nozzle temperature | 240–260°C |
|---|---|
| Bed temperature | 70–80°C |
| Enclosure | Not needed |
| Hardened nozzle | Required (abrasive) |
| Drying | Critical — always dry before printing |
Strengths & weaknesses
- Strengths: PETG toughness with carbon stiffness and a premium matte surface.
- Weaknesses: abrasive (hardened nozzle mandatory), must be dried, costs 2–3× PETG.

FAQ
What temperature should I print PETG-CF at?
Nozzle 240–260°C, bed 70–80°C. Start mid-range and tune with a temperature tower — exact sweet spots vary by brand and color.
Does PETG-CF need an enclosure?
No — PETG-CF prints fine on an open-frame printer. Normal indoor conditions are all it needs; an enclosure is optional.
Does PETG-CF need drying?
Drying is critical for PETG-CF. It absorbs moisture from the air within hours of opening; wet filament prints with popping, stringing, weak layers, and a rough surface. Dry it before every session and keep it in a dryer or dry box while printing.
